Guidance Regarding Garment Selection and Maintenance

The subsequent information provides guidance related to the acquisition, care, and appropriate usage of garments sharing characteristics with a “for love and lemons baby’s breath dress”. This guidance aims to maximize longevity and maintain the intended aesthetic of such pieces.

Tip 1: Material Assessment: Prior to purchase, meticulously examine the fabric composition. Delicate materials, frequently employed in similar styles, require specialized cleaning methods. Consider the climate and occasion when assessing breathability and comfort.

Tip 2: Seam Integrity: Inspect all seams for secure stitching and absence of loose threads. Fragile fabrics are susceptible to tearing if seams are poorly constructed. Reinforcement of stress points may be necessary for increased durability.

Tip 3: Undergarment Selection: Opt for undergarments that complement the garment’s sheerness and silhouette. Seamless options are recommended to prevent visible lines and maintain a smooth appearance.

Tip 4: Cleaning Protocol: Adhere strictly to the care label instructions. Professional dry cleaning is generally recommended for delicate fabrics. Hand washing, if specified, necessitates gentle detergents and careful handling.

Tip 5: Storage Practices: Store the garment in a breathable garment bag, away from direct sunlight and humidity. Avoid overcrowding in the closet to prevent creasing and potential damage to delicate embellishments.

Tip 6: Alteration Considerations: Should alterations be necessary, engage a skilled tailor experienced in working with delicate fabrics. Improper alterations can compromise the garment’s structure and aesthetic appeal.

Tip 7: Accessory Compatibility: Select accessories that complement the garment’s delicate nature. Avoid overly heavy or abrasive items that could snag or damage the fabric.

1. Fabric Delicacy

1. Fabric Delicacy, Breath

Fabric delicacy is a defining characteristic intrinsically linked to the aesthetic and practical considerations of a For Love & Lemons baby’s breath dress. The choice of delicate fabrics is central to achieving the garment’s signature ethereal and romantic appearance, but it also presents specific challenges related to care, durability, and wearability.

  • Material Vulnerability

    The utilization of lightweight, sheer materials such as chiffon, lace, and silk blends renders the garment inherently susceptible to damage. Snagging, tearing, and discoloration from sunlight or improper handling are significant concerns. The inherent fragility of these fabrics necessitates careful storage and cleaning protocols, including professional dry cleaning or gentle hand washing.

  • Structural Integrity

    Delicate fabrics possess limited structural integrity, requiring meticulous construction techniques to maintain the garment’s shape and prevent distortion. Reinforcements at stress points, such as seams and closures, are critical for ensuring longevity. The choice of interlinings and underlays further influences the garment’s drape and overall durability.

  • Transparency and Layering

    The inherent transparency of many delicate fabrics necessitates strategic layering and undergarment selection. Slip dresses or camisoles are often required to provide modesty and enhance the garment’s silhouette. The choice of undergarments should complement the fabric’s color and texture to avoid visual distractions.

  • Environmental Sensitivity

    Delicate fabrics are particularly sensitive to environmental factors, including humidity, heat, and chemicals. Exposure to direct sunlight can cause fading or discoloration. Contact with harsh chemicals, such as perfumes or hairsprays, can result in staining or degradation of the fabric. Protective measures, such as storing the garment in a garment bag and avoiding direct contact with harmful substances, are essential for preserving its quality.

Frequently Asked Questions

The following questions address common inquiries and misconceptions surrounding garments possessing similar design characteristics to a “For Love & Lemons Baby’s Breath Dress”. These answers aim to provide clarity and inform decision-making processes related to acquisition and care.

Question 1: What distinguishes this particular style of garment from other dress designs?

The defining characteristics include the use of delicate fabrics (e.g., lace, chiffon), intricate detailing (e.g., embroidery, ruffles), and a silhouette that evokes a sense of romanticism and femininity. These elements combine to create a distinct aesthetic that sets it apart from more utilitarian or casual designs.

Question 2: Are these garments suitable for all body types?

While the flowing silhouettes are generally flattering, the specific fit and drape may vary depending on individual body proportions. Careful consideration of sizing charts and, ideally, a fitting session are recommended to ensure optimal comfort and visual appeal.

Question 3: What is the expected lifespan of a garment of this style?

The lifespan is contingent upon the frequency of wear, the care practices employed, and the quality of the original materials and construction. With proper care, a garment of this type can last for several years, but it is inherently more delicate than more robustly constructed clothing items.

Question 4: What are the recommended cleaning methods for these delicate fabrics?

Professional dry cleaning is generally recommended to minimize the risk of damage. Hand-washing, if specified on the care label, requires the use of gentle detergents and careful handling to avoid stretching or shrinking the fabric.

Question 5: Can alterations be performed on these garments without compromising their design?

Alterations are possible but should be undertaken by a skilled tailor experienced in working with delicate fabrics. Improper alterations can distort the silhouette and damage the intricate detailing, diminishing the garment’s overall aesthetic.

Question 6: What types of accessories best complement this style of dress?

Delicate jewelry, such as fine necklaces and bracelets, and understated footwear, such as strappy sandals or ballet flats, generally complement the garment’s aesthetic. Avoid overly heavy or bulky accessories that could overwhelm the delicate fabric and design.
